Who needs return of organization exempt?

01
Non-profit organizations that are recognized by the IRS as tax-exempt under section 501(c)(3) or other applicable sections of the tax code.
02
Organizations with annual gross receipts over $200,000 or total assets over $500,000.
03
Organizations that are required to file an annual information return with the IRS.
04
Organizations that want to maintain their tax-exempt status and comply with IRS regulations.

The return of organization exempt is a form that t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S to report their financial information.
Tax-exempt organizations, including charities, religious organizations, and other nonprofits, are required to file a return of organization exempt.
Tax-exempt organizations can fill out the return of organization exempt form by providing information about their income, expenses, and activities.
The purpose of the return of organization exempt is to provide the IRS and the public with information about a tax-exempt organization's finances and activities.
Tax-exempt organizations must report information such as their revenue, expenses, assets, and activities on the return of organization exempt form.
